Archer Aviation, United Airlines Establishing Air Taxi Route in Chicago
by DRONELIFE Staff Writer Ian M. Crosby
Today, Archer Aviation and United Airlines announced plans to launch Chicago’s first air taxi route. The route will be situated between O’Hare International Airport (ORD) and Vertiport Chicago, the largest vertical aircraft take off and landing facility in the nation. This location was chosen as a result of the convenience, access and service it offers. Passengers will be able to travel to and from ORD using Archer’s Midnight aircraft in around 10 minutes, a trip that can take over an hour by car.
The two companies intend for their UAM network to provide Chicago residents and visitors with a safe, renewable, quiet, and cost-competitive alternative to ground transportation starting in 2025.
